Labour market overview, situation as of 31 October 2023

The number of unemployed people registered with public employment services in Bosnia and Herzegovina on 31 October 2023 was 346 051. As compared to a month earlier, this number was lower by 797 persons or 0.23%. Out of the total number of job seekers, 202 252 or 58.45% were women. In comparison to the same period of the year earlier, unemployment in BiH was lower by 11 261 persons or 3.15%.

Unemployment decreased in Federation of BiH by 471 persons (0.17%), in Republika Srpska by 347 persons (0.58%) but increased in the Brčko District of BiH by 21 persons (0.16%).

Job seekers by qualification levels, situation as of 31 October 2023:

100 461 unskilled workers or 29.03%, of whom 59 905 (29.64%) women;

5 247 semi-skilled workers – lower educational background or 1.52%, of whom 2 728 (1.35%) women;

108 345 skilled workers or 31.31%, of whom 52 207 (25.81%) women;

901 highly skilled workers or 0.26%, of whom 187 (0.09%) women;

97 721 with secondary education or 28.24%, of whom 63 752 (31.52%) women;

5 392 with two-year post-secondary education or 1.56%, of whom 3 558 (1.76%) women;

27 984 with university degree or 8.09%, of whom 19 870 (9.82%) women.

A total of 20 681 people were deregistered from public employment services in Octomber, of whom 10 189 were women. Out of this number, there were 8 157 flows into employment, of which 4 403 were women. 

At the same time employment terminated for 10 548 people, of whom 5 437 were women.  In the same period, employers reported 5 437 vacancies. 

According to BiH Agency for Statistics, the number of people in employment in BiH in September 2023 stood at 850 523, of whom 383 735 were women.  In comparison to August 2023, the number of people in employment was increased by 0.8% and the number of employed women increased by 1.4%.

Registered unemployment rate for September 2023 was 29.0% and was 0.3 percentage point lower than in August 2023.
